![]() ![]() ![]() The purpose of the wizards' school in Earthsea is to teach one how to use magic without upsetting the balance of the world. There are competing magical forces: not so much between light and darkness, as between the wise and sensible use of magic - and darkness. There are dragons, for whom the ancient tongue is native, but they are not to be trusted: while incapable of lying, they have different conceptions of truth. To know someone's true name is to have power over him or her it is vouchsafed only to those whom one trusts utterly. Earthsea is an imaginary archipelago, the traditional pre-industrial world of children's fantasy literature, but governed by a supremely compelling and simple idea: there is an ancient language of creation, and anyone who has the gift of sorcery and who can speak that language, in which things are given their true, as opposed to arbitrarily phonemic names, can master their physical presence. ![]()
